On Wed, Aug 18, 2010 at 02:42:09PM +0200, Thomas Steen Rasmussen wrote:
> On 18-08-2010 14:11, Pawel Jakub Dawidek wrote:
> >I'm very glad to hear that. I changed the default MAX_SEND_SIZE to 32kB
> >as it seems to be the safest setting. I had similar problem in ggate.
> >
> >   
> 
> OK. So it will be (or has been) committed to the tree ? What about MFC ? 
> I should
> probably know this, but:
> What does this mean, like, when will this fix be in -STABLE or even in a 
> -RELEASE ?

I just committed it to FreeBSD-CURRENT, it will be merged to
FreeBSD-STABLE (8-STABLE) in three weeks and will be available in
8.2-RELEASE when it is released.
